Project Overview
Open Notebook is an open-source, privacy-focused alternative to Google's Notebook LM. It's a research assistant that allows users to manage research, generate AI-assisted notes, and interact with content through Streamlit UI and REST API, backed by SurrealDB.

Architecture Overview
Three-Layer Architecture
- Frontend: Streamlit UI (
app_home.pyand/pages/) - API: FastAPI backend (
/api/) on port 5055 - Database: SurrealDB graph database
Key Directories
/open_notebook/domain/: Domain models (notebook, models, transformation)/open_notebook/graphs/: LangGraph processing (chat, ask, source, transformation)/open_notebook/database/: SurrealDB repository pattern/api/: REST API endpoints/pages/: Streamlit UI pages/migrations/: Database migrations
Data Storage
/data/uploads/: User-uploaded files/data/podcasts/: Generated podcasts/data/sqlite-db/: LangGraph checkpoints/surreal_data/: SurrealDB files
AI Provider Integration
The project uses the Esperanto library for multi-provider AI support:
- Language models: OpenAI, Anthropic, Google, Groq, Ollama, Mistral, DeepSeek, xAI, OpenRouter
- Embeddings: OpenAI, Google, Ollama, Mistral, Voyage
- Speech: OpenAI, Groq, ElevenLabs, Google TTS
Model configuration is centralized through ModelManager class in /open_notebook/domain/models.py.
Database Operations
Uses SurrealDB with async operations:
# Create record
await repo_create(table: str, data: dict)
# Upsert (merge) record
await repo_upsert(table: str, record_id: Union[str, RecordID], data: dict)
# Query
await repo_query("SELECT * FROM table WHERE field = $value", {"value": "example"})
# Delete
await repo_delete(record_id)
Database Migrations
Database schema migrations run automatically when the API starts up. The migration system:
- Uses
AsyncMigrationManagerfrom/open_notebook/database/async_migrate.py - Runs in the FastAPI
lifespanevent handler in/api/main.py - Checks current database version against available migrations in
/migrations/ - Executes pending migrations sequentially on startup
- Tracks migration state in the
_sbl_migrationstable - Fails fast if migrations encounter errors (preventing API startup with outdated schema)
Important: Database migrations are now handled by the API. The Streamlit UI migration check (pages/stream_app/utils.py:check_migration()) is deprecated and does nothing. Always ensure the API is running before using the React frontend or Streamlit UI.
Troubleshooting:
- If the API fails to start, check logs for migration errors
- Verify SurrealDB is running:
docker compose ps surrealdb - Check database connection settings in
.env - Migration files must exist in
/migrations/directory - For manual migration rollback, use down migration files (not automated)
Content Processing Pipeline
- Content ingestion (files, URLs, text) via
/open_notebook/graphs/source.py - Text extraction using Content-Core library
- Embedding generation for semantic search
- Transformation workflows in
/open_notebook/graphs/transformation.py
